
The Future of AI and Robotics: What’s Next?
The next decade will witness rapid advancements in AI and robotics, pushing the boundaries of what machines can achieve. Experts predict that future AI-powered robots will possess greater autonomy, enhanced cognitive abilities, and improved adaptability to real-world environments.
Predictions for the future of AI and robotics:
General AI (AGI) in robots: Unlike today’s AI, which is specialized for specific tasks, AGI will enable robots to think and learn like humans, adapting to multiple scenarios without predefined instructions.
Fully autonomous factories and workplaces: AI-driven automation will lead to smart workplaces where robots manage entire operations with minimal human intervention.
AI-enhanced human-robot collaboration: Instead of replacing humans, future robots will work alongside people, augmenting their capabilities rather than eliminating jobs.
Space exploration robots: AI-powered robotic explorers will help colonize Mars and conduct deep-space missions beyond human reach.
The evolution of AI and robotics will reshape industries, redefine economies, and transform everyday life. While challenges such as regulation, ethics, and public acceptance remain, the potential of intelligent machines to enhance human capabilities is limitless.
